The Sinking City Remastered Launches with Unreal Engine 5 Upgrade
Eduard Zamikhovsky
Frogwares has surprise-released The Sinking City Remastered, an updated version of its Lovecraftian horror adventure. The remaster, first announced in late March, is now available on PC, Xbox Series X/S, and PS5. Players who own the original game can upgrade for free.
Inspired by the works of H.P. Lovecraft, The Sinking City follows a private detective who arrives in the half-submerged town of Oakmont, where the locals are gripped by madness. Players must uncover the mystery behind the city's descent into chaos.
The remaster runs on Unreal Engine 5 and brings major upgrades, including improved lighting and visuals, 4K textures, ray tracing, and support for FSR, DLSS, and frame generation. It also adds gameplay tweaks and a full photo mode.
